Message type: E = Error
Message class: ME - Purchasing: General Messages
Message number: 882
Message text: Non-existent delivery item &/& in packing item

- Non-existent delivery item &/& in packing item ?The SAP error message ME882 "Non-existent delivery item &/& in packing item" typically occurs in the context of logistics and delivery processing within the SAP system. This error indicates that the system is unable to find a specific delivery item that is referenced in a packing item. Here’s a breakdown of the cause, potential solutions, and related information:
Cause:
- Incorrect Delivery Item Reference: The delivery item number referenced in the packing item does not exist in the system. This could be due to a typo or an incorrect entry.
- Deleted or Inactive Delivery Item: The delivery item may have been deleted or is no longer active in the system.
-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the database, such as missing entries or corruption in the delivery or packing data.
- Incorrect Configuration: The configuration settings for delivery and packing processes may not be set up correctly, leading to issues in item referencing.
Solutions:
- Verify Delivery Item: Check the delivery item number referenced in the error message. Ensure that it exists in the system and is active. You can do this by navigating to the delivery document in SAP and confirming the item details.
- Check Packing Items: Review the packing items associated with the delivery. Ensure that they are correctly linked to valid delivery items.
- Recreate Delivery: If the delivery item is indeed missing or has been deleted, you may need to recreate the delivery or adjust the packing items accordingly.
- Data Consistency Check: Run consistency checks in the system to identify and resolve any data inconsistencies. This may involve using transaction codes like SE11 (Data Dictionary) or SE16 (Data Browser) to inspect the relevant tables.
- Consult S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error. There may be patches or updates that resolve known issues.
- Configuration Review: If the issue persists, review the configuration settings related to delivery and packing processes in the SAP system. Ensure that all necessary settings are correctly configured.
